#713cc1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#713cc1 is composed of 44.3% red, 23.5%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.5%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 263.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 49.6%. #713cc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e278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#713cc1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#713cc1 has RGB values of R:113, G:60,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7421121.

Shades and Tints of #713cc1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08040d is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#713cc1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7687 is the less saturated color, while #6502fb is the most saturated one.
